In regards to the power outage conversation...I am seven games in to this set and the one item that really stands out the most for me so far is I am striking out far more than I have in the past and my misses are between 30-35%, which is massively higher than the target for this slider set. All of those misses are driving everything down, including home runs.
I am going to play a few more to get a solid 10-game spread, but I suspect kicking timing +1 will slightly lower K’s and misses and increase better contact, which should in turn help with getting the ball deeper more often.Comment

Thanks for the update. I had bumped timing for a while on one franchise and my strikeouts got to 8 per game which is perfect. Yet the power was still not there. My misses were a little high at 26% or so. The timing slider confuses me a little this year, as i bumped it up to 4 with this set and only struck out 5 times per game, over 15 or 20 games. But then - i raised solid hits to 4, played another 15 or 20 games (with timing still at 4) and i started striking out 7 or 8 times per game lol. Playing the same patient way. Ive never noticed anything like that before in all my slider testing.
